Sweden are the betting favourites for this year's Eurovision Song Contest

Betting is hotting up for this year's Eurovision Song Contest and it is Sweden who are the favourites with bookmakers to win this year's competition.

Former winner Loreen will be representing Sweden again with her song 'Tattoo' seeing the country's odds come tumbling down to win to odds-on at 5/6.

Loreen won Eurovision back in 2012 with her winning song 'Euphoria' arguably one of the most recognisable Song Contest performances in the history of the competition.

William Hill now say there's a 54% chance that Sweden win the Song Contest which will take place in Liverpool next month.

Odds also given for the two Semi-Finals on Eurovision week

Eurovision week doesn't just see the main Song Contest take place but we also have two Semi-Finals too with 10 countries on both days qualifying for Eurovision.

26 countries will compete in the Eurovision Song Contest with the host broadcaster and the Big 5 of France, Germany, Spain, Italy and the United Kingdom all qualifying automatically for the final show.

The host broadcaster this year was meant to be last year's winners Ukraine but the UK are hosting the event instead due to the ongoing war with Russia, but Ukraine will also automatically qualify for the show.

When will the Eurovision Song Contest take place?

The 2023 Eurovision Song Contest is set to take place on May 13th 2023 live from the Liverpool Arena in Liverpool, United Kingdom.

Graham Norton has been announced as the host of the final of the Eurovision Song Contest 2023 alongside Britain's Got Talent judge Alesha Dixon, Ted Lasso actress Hannah Waddingham and Ukrainian singer Julia Sanina.

Tickets went on sale last month for the Semi-Final's, Final and other rehearsal events across the week and they all sold out in a matter of hours with unprecedented demand.
